Brian Harding is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Genetics.
According to data from OpenAlex, Brian Harding has authored 157 papers receiving a total of 6.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 61 papers in Molecular Biology, 28 papers in Epidemiology and 27 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Brian Harding’s work include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(23 papers), Epilepsy research and treatment (19 papers) and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(14 papers). Brian Harding is often cited by papers focused on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(23 papers), Epilepsy research and treatment (19 papers) and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(14 papers). Brian Harding coll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and India. Brian Harding's co-authors include Rajesh V. Thakker, J. Helen Cross, William Harkness, Maria Thom and Michael R. Bowl and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
